An epic poem is a lengthy narrative poem, ordinarily involving a time beyond living memory in which occurred the extraordinary doings of the extraordinary men and women who, in dealings with the gods or other superhuman forces, gave shape to the mortal universe for their descendants, the poet and their audience, to understand themselves as a people or nation.

Eliot is a three-stanza poem that is separated into sets of lines that vary in length. The first stanza contains twenty lines, the second: eleven, and the third: twelve. The poem does not have a structured rhyme scheme, although there are a number of instances in which end words or phrases repeat.

Dante's poem is heavily allegorical, which means that there are countless individual, minor symbols throughout the text that stand for larger ideas. However, one major symbol that recurs throughout the poem is the idea of the journey. The first line of the poem compares dante's life to a road or path which dante is halfway through.
